Nothing to Wear

The next time I get "nothing to wear" syndrome when I look in my closet, I'm going to come back and read this. I usually don't prefer translations from The Message, but this passage really benefited from a modern update. I discovered it from this blog about a family of six living off of $28,000 a year. The mom reminded me of my friend, Sharon, who often prays before she goes shopping. When I was younger, I admit I thought that was pretty silly. Now I can see the wisdom in it. Here's the passage:


27-29“Has anyone by fussing in front of the mirror ever gotten taller by so much as an inch? All this time and money wasted on fashion—do you think it makes that much difference?
Instead of looking at the fashions, walk out into the fields and look at the wildflowers. They never primp or shop, but have you ever seen color and design quite like it? The ten best-dressed men and women in the country look shabby alongside them.
30-33“If God gives such attention to the appearance of wildflowers—most of which are never even seen—don’t you think he’ll attend to you, take pride in you, do his best for you? What I’m trying to do here is to get you to relax, to not be so preoccupied with gettingso you can respond to God’s giving.
People who don’t know God and the way he works fuss over these things, but you know both God and how he works. Steep your life in God-reality, God-initiative, God-provisions. Don’t worry about missing out. You’ll find all your everyday human concerns will be met.
Matthew 6:29-33
